Abstract

The invention provides an electromagnetic sunshade curtain, which comprises a driving system, a top beam, a guide rail, a curtain mat and a control device, wherein the top beam is connected with the guide rail; the guide rails are vertically arranged on two sides, and the top beam is fixed on the top between the guide rails; a first rail and a second rail are arranged on the guide rail in parallel; the driving system is arranged on the top beam and is connected with the top end of the curtain mat; the curtain mat comprises curtain body groups and a curtain bottom sheet which are connected with each other, wherein each curtain body group consists of a curtain strip, a connecting block and a turning sheet; the middle part of the turning piece is provided with a middle hinged hook, the back side of the top of the turning piece is fixedly provided with a magnet, the back side of the inner cavity of the curtain strip is fixedly provided with a metal strip which can be magnetized, and the turning piece is hinged to the bottom hinged groove of the curtain strip through the middle hinged hook, so that the top of the turning piece is embedded in the inner cavity; the control device comprises an auxiliary driving group, a sliding support, an electromagnetic unit and a controller. The invention can control half-open of any area and meet the requirements of any indoor personnel.

Electromagnetic sun-shading curtain
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of sun-shading devices, in particular to an electromagnetic sun-shading curtain.
Background
Electric sun-shading curtain products applied to architectural windows are gradually popularized, and the requirements are that the electric sun-shading curtain products can be opened and closed to shade or collect light, prevent wind, ventilate and the like.
The electric sunshade curtain products in the prior art can either completely shade or completely open the sunlight. Partial products can realize semi-lighting ventilation by utilizing the interaction between the curtain sheets, but the semi-lighting ventilation state is uniformly distributed in the whole curtain mat or realized in a specific area according to a specific rule, and the semi-lighting ventilation in any area cannot be manually controlled. The different requirements for the personnel in the room are difficult to satisfy individually.
It is obvious that the prior art has certain defects.

Examples
Referring to fig. 1 to 4, the present invention provides an electromagnetic sunshade curtain, which includes a driving system 1, a top beam 2, a guide rail 3, a curtain mat and a control device 4; the guide rails 3 are vertically arranged on two sides, and the top beam 2 is fixed on the top between the guide rails 3; a first rail 5 and a second rail 6 are arranged on the guide rail 3 in parallel; the driving system 1 is arranged on the top beam 2 and is connected with the top end of the curtain mat;
the curtain mat comprises curtain body groups and a curtain bottom sheet 7 which are connected with each other, wherein each curtain body group consists of a curtain strip 8, a connecting block 9 and a turning sheet 10; the curtain strips 8 are transversely arranged, two ends of each curtain strip are connected with the first rail 5 in a sliding mode, the top of each curtain strip is provided with a top hinge groove 14 extending along the axial direction, the bottom of each curtain strip is provided with a bottom hinge groove 15 extending along the axial direction, and an inner cavity 16 is arranged inside each bottom hinge groove 15; the top of the connecting block 9 is provided with a top hinge hook, the bottom of the connecting block 9 is provided with a bottom hinge hook, the top hinge hook is hinged in the bottom hinge groove 15, the bottom hinge hook is hinged in the top hinge groove 14, and two adjacent curtain strips 8 are connected through a plurality of connecting blocks 9 which are transversely arranged at intervals; the middle part of the turning piece 10 is provided with a middle hinged hook, the back side of the top part of the turning piece 10 is fixedly provided with a magnet 17, the back side of the inner cavity 16 of the curtain strip 8 is fixedly provided with a metal strip 18 which can be magnetized, the turning piece 10 is hinged to the bottom hinged groove 15 of the curtain strip 8 through the middle hinged hook, so that the top part of the turning piece 10 is embedded in the inner cavity 16, and the turning pieces 10 are transversely arranged in the interval of the connecting block 9; the curtain bottom sheet 7 is connected with the bottom end of the curtain mat;
the control device 4 comprises a secondary driving group 11, a sliding bracket 12, an electromagnetic unit 13 and a controller; the sliding support 12 is transversely arranged, two ends of the sliding support are connected with the second rail 6 in a sliding mode, and the auxiliary driving group 11 is in transmission connection with the sliding support 12 and drives the sliding support 12 to slide up and down; a plurality of electromagnetic units 13 are arranged on the sliding bracket 12, and the positions of the electromagnetic units 13 correspond to the turning pieces 10; each electromagnetic unit 13 is electrically connected to the controller.
The invention is characterized in that the turning pieces 10 arranged between two adjacent curtain strips 8 can be controlled independently through magnetism, thereby forming any specific half-open pattern and meeting the ventilation and lighting requirements of any indoor position. This is achieved by the control device 4, which is of a scanning type, so that the construction is considerably simplified.
The working principle of the invention is as follows: the whole curtain mat can be opened and closed through the driving system 1, and the full-opening or full-closing effect is achieved. When the half-open lighting and ventilation of the turning piece 10 are needed, a specific half-open area is drawn through the controller. The controller stores and feeds drawing information back to each electromagnetic unit 13 of the control device 4, the sliding support 12 is controlled to slide along the second rail 6, the 'scanning' action of the whole curtain is realized, in the scanning process, each electromagnetic unit 13 works in a cooperation mode to control the opening and closing of each row of turning pieces 10, and when the scanning action is finished, the opening and closing area formed by all the turning pieces 10 of the whole curtain is the area drawn by the controller.
The opening and closing control of each flap 10 by the electromagnetic unit 13 is realized by an electromagnetic principle. Because the top of the flap 10 is provided with the magnet 17, the flap 10 can be controlled to be opened as long as the electromagnetic unit 13 sends out a magnetic field in a specific direction to attract the magnet 17 to move backwards. The magnet 17 of the opened flap 10 adheres to the metal sheet of the inner cavity 16, and the opened state can be fixed although the magnetism is small. When all the turning pieces 10 need to be closed again or the shape of the opening and closing region formed by the turning pieces 10 needs to be changed, the auxiliary driving group 11 drives the sliding support 12 to scan reversely again, and controls all the electromagnetic units 13 to generate a reverse magnetic field to generate repulsion to the magnet 17, so that all the turning pieces 10 can be closed again to realize 'erasing'. The controller may be in various forms, for example, a small liquid crystal screen, or a communication processing unit for remote control with an external device such as a mobile phone.
Due to the limited range of action of the magnet 17 from the electromagnetic unit 13, it is preferred that the distance from the magnet 17 at the top of the flap 10 to the middle hinge hook is smaller than the distance from the bottom of the flap 10 to the middle hinge hook. The flap 10 is thus a laborious lever, but the magnet 17 has a short working distance from the metal sheet or the electromagnetic unit 13.
Referring to fig. 3 in detail, the secondary driving set 11 preferably comprises a transmission belt, a secondary motor (not shown), a pulley and a synchronous shaft (not shown); the belt wheel is rotatably arranged on the guide rails 3, the synchronizing shaft is arranged between the guide rails 3 and is in transmission connection with the belt wheels on the two guide rails 3, the transmission belt is axially arranged along the guide rails 3 and is wound on the upper belt wheel and the lower belt wheel, and the auxiliary motor is in transmission connection with the synchronizing shaft and is electrically connected with the controller.
The use of a belt drive is a preferred configuration for the secondary drive train 11. The belt transmission mechanism has the advantages of low price, stable transmission, simple structure, small occupied space and the like.
Preferably, the control device 4 further includes an inductive switch (not shown) mounted on the sliding bracket 12 and electrically connected to the controller.
The inductive switch can send out an inductive signal in the process of passing through each curtain strip 8 in the scanning process of the control device 4, so that the inductive signal is fed back to the controller to control the electromagnetic unit 13 to make corresponding changes.
Structurally, preferably, the front side of the top of the curtain strip 8 is provided with an embedding part 19 matched with the bottom edge of the turning piece 10, and the bottom edge is covered on the embedding part 19 when the turning piece 10 is closed, so that the outside strong wind and rainwater can be resisted after the turning piece 10 is closed.
Preferably, the driving system 1 includes a driving motor and a winding drum; the top end of the curtain mat is connected with the winding drum, and the driving motor is in transmission connection with the winding drum. This is comparable to the roller blind products of the prior art.
According to the electromagnetic sunshade curtain provided by the invention, the turning pieces 10 in the curtain mat are innovatively controlled line by line through the working mode of controller scanning, and the region needing semi-lighting and ventilation in one curtain mat can be drawn out in any room like painting, so that the requirements of any indoor personnel are met. Compared with the situation that each turnover piece 10 is independently provided with an electromagnetic device for control, the scheme of the invention is simpler and more efficient, and the problems of difficult wiring, high cost and the like can be avoided. Meanwhile, the fully-opened or fully-closed function of the existing sun-shading product is kept.
